Question:
You make a galvanic cell with a piece of nickel, \(1.0 \mathrm{M}\) \(\mathrm{Ni}^{2+}(a q)\), a piece of silver, and \(1.0 \mathrm{M} \mathrm{Ag}^{+}(a q)\). Calculate the concentrations of \(\mathrm{Ag}^{+}(a q)\) and \(\mathrm{Ni}^{2+}(a q)\) once the cell is "dead."
